It’s one year after his miraculous transformation and Ebenezer Scrooge is back to his old ways. He is suing Jacob Marley and the Ghosts of Christmas Past, Present and Future for breaking and entering, kidnapping, slander, pain and suffering, attempted murder and the intentional infliction of emotional distress. The ghosts employ Solomon Rothschild, England’s most charismatic, savvy and clever barrister. Scrooge, that old penny-pincher, represents himself. Various witnesses are called to the stand and each contributes pieces of the story which Scrooge promptly contradicts. When his old fiancée Belle takes the stand, she forces Scrooge to face the mistakes of his past where he chose money over happiness. In the end, Scrooge has a change of heart … but until then, comedy reigns in this court room!
